! Uploaded for educational purposes !
After the victory of Ottomans at 1596 Siege of Eger, Austrian and Ottoman armies clashed in Battle of Keresztes. Which resulted with Austrian Defeat. The song is satirizing Austrians about these events.

Fellow viewers, If you're thinking that "Nemçe means Austrian, not German" I am here to explain why I wrote German here. While translating, I searched the roots of the word "Nemçe" then found out that this word is actually coming from Slavic origin which means literally "German". E.g: Serbian "Nemački", Polish "Niemiecki". So I decided to write "German" there. It didn't sound wrong if we consider that Austrians are German and were the Emperor of Holy Roman Empire. Then I wrote to description that the events happened between Austrians and Ottomans. But maybe I shouldn't be more focused on meaning and written more specifically "Austrian" some people got confused because of it. So this is why I wrote "German" instead of "Austrian", I hope I was able to explain myself, Thanks for all the views and comments.

I think this would be a better translation. Küffar sanur hüccet almış Eğri'ye Hali benzer nefes çekmiş bengiye Bire sorun Nemçelüye Lehliye Ne de çabuk unuttular Muhaç'ı Yağız atın dikelince yelesi Başımızdan esti gaza nefesi Bre sorun nerde Nemçe kölesi Dayanır mı Zülfikare kellesi Haberler iletin Beç Çasarı'na Durmasın kılıcın sarsın donuna Er ise buyursun er meydanına Ne de çabuk unuttular Muhaç'ı Infidels think that Eger is under their jurisdiction, They look like they have smoked weed. Ask those Germans and Poles, How quickly did they forget Mohács? When the manes of my black horse stood up(flew), The breath of battle blew over us, Ask now, where is the Austrian slave? Can his head resist to the blade of Zulfiqar? Send a message to the Emperor in Vienna, Tell him to don his sword without delay. Tell him to come to the battlefied if he's man enough, How quickly did they forget Mohács?

Yep he was the well known singer Hasan Mutlucan (he is deceased now). Throughout the seventies and eighties, radio and TV stations used to broadcast heroic songs by him on national days. Even during the military juntas of 1971 and 1980, one of the first things the military juntas did when they seized the power was to broadcast his songs.

As a Turkish who's into history and have multiple historical figures in my family myself and as someone who knows my ancestors culture and who is proud to be Turkish I would like to add things to clarify, This is not an Ottoman March eventho we don't know if the lyrics are very accurate because of the wrong event chains mentioned in the lyrics yet it is a ''serhat'' more like a ''rumeli'' folk song which is belived to transferred(more or less) by generations in rumeli/balkans it has nothing to do with middle east or palestin.(Btw, Peace for palestine). Eventho there were a lot of ethnicities in Ottomans, In serhat(borderlines) they were always Turkic Beys and tribes placed by the head of goverment, Those are called Akıncı they were all light cavalary so it has turkic elements in the lyrics and composition, as a horse was everything to Turkish ''Akıncıs'' which encountered Nemçes a lot at that time on the border. Its known that it is sang for the victory in Eğri which is in todays world Hungary. On the other hand Nemçe was a general term for the Austrians and Austria not the Germans so again it has nothing to do with Arab lands. Besides victories, there are also epics and folk songs about defeats, such as ''aldı nemçe nazlı budin'', Also there are a lot of ''Turkish folk songs'' like this, It was compiled by Sadi Yaver Ataman mostly such as, buna er meydanı derler, belgrat kalesi zemlin ovası, kırım'dan gelirim, yine de şahlanıyor, bülbüller ötüyor, alişimin kaşları kare, köşküm var deryaya karşı, estergon kalesi, bulut gelir seher ile, those above are some of the Rumelian/Balkan Turks cultural songs transcribed by Kemal Altınkaya. Again has nothing to do with middle east.... Also this song has two different stles one is this one and the other one is hasan mutlucan's version.
